Output d31bfa66425f33f68ec6b5af0975c8d3550838e1cb6c96925db28a085a02ac34:0

value
590200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d7e6b242d94e41cbd27e379ebbacb31eccb1fa OP_EQUAL
address
34xYDLHF8D8q1acPXn4xa4zF4Cjwu8KivU
transaction
d31bfa66425f33f68ec6b5af0975c8d3550838e1cb6c96925db28a085a02ac34
spent
true